The Venetian Court homes become part of a central home owners organization, with each house owner paying $179 per month, which approaches communal expenses like upkeep of the general public pathways, illumination, water and even preserving the seawall that secures the homes from the sea. That seawall can not completely shield the homes, with winter season tornados breaching the concrete obstacle year after year.


Mike said locals utilized to just place sandbags and plywood before their front doors, now people are boarding up almost the whole front of the home each winter months. "We're absolutely taking much more preventative measures than we have in the past," Mike stated. He claimed during a tornado in the early 1980s, their home withstood rather substantial damage and needed to undertake lots of repair services, but they have actually been fortunate since.


This past winter season, the Newells were traveling throughout the most awful of the tornados, though if they had actually been home, they would have needed to leave. While the 2nd row of homes often tends to sustain much less damage when a big tornado rolls via, Gagne said storms in the past 2 years triggered water to leak into her family members's home and damage some rug.


The Newells stated they get insurance coverage from the National Flood Insurance Coverage Program, a federal government program run by FEMA typically booked for those that own home where flooding insurance policy isn't available or is too pricey. They claimed prices have actually climbed recently, however it's "absolutely nothing shocking" a tranquil response when prices are shooting up throughout the state and insurance firms are taking out altogether.

He sees the Venetian Court location whenever there's a large winter season storm event, and has seen the effects of climate change speed up, he claimed. There simply isn't a great solution to avoid future catastrophes for homes perched so precariously right alongside the sea. "Individuals don't want to consider [taken care of hideaway], but in the lengthy run, that is the only solution.


The very best temporary solution is to elevate the seawall before the homes, he said, though he admits it will certainly alter their attractive sea views. It additionally will not be an easy decision for the state's Coastal Commission, which would certainly have to authorize the modifications to the seawall, or for the Venetian Court HOA, which owns the seawall and would inevitably need to spend for its modification.
